Common failure points for the LiftMaster LA500 often include worn internal gears within the actuator arm, strained motor brushes from excessive use or resistance, and occasional circuit board malfunctions triggered by power surges during Franklin's summer thunderstorms or moisture ingress from thawing snow. A faulty limit switch can also cause erratic gate behavior, preventing it from fully opening or closing. This often indicates a worn gearbox inside the LA500's linear actuator or insufficient power. Franklin's varying temperatures and debris can degrade internal components over time, leading to increased friction and reduced efficiency, particularly in areas like the DelCarte Conservation Area.
Frequently a sign of malfunctioning limit switches. These critical sensors tell the operator when the gate has reached its fully open or closed position; if they are dirty, misaligned, or faulty due to environmental exposure, the operator will stop prematurely.
These sounds typically point to internal mechanical issues within the actuator arm, such as stripped gears or misaligned linkages. The demanding climate, from freezing winters to humid summers, can accelerate wear on these intricate parts.
This suggests an electrical short circuit, potentially caused by damaged wiring, a failing motor, or a faulty control board. Franklin's frequent thunderstorms can sometimes lead to power surges that damage sensitive electronics, necessitating prompt attention.
While sometimes a simple battery issue, it can also indicate a problem with the LA500's receiver board or antenna. Interference from other devices, or damage from moisture common during spring thaws in Franklin, can degrade signal reception and require expert diagnosis.
